Cora Henry Obituary

FRANKLIN - Cora Lee Hopper Henry, 80, passed away Monday, July 7, 2025, after a period of declining health.
Cora was born Nov. 21, 1944, to the late Alex and Maggie McDowell Hopper. In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her husband, James "Pratt" Henry; an unborn grandchild; sisters, Mary Rose Helton and Mable Gregory; and brother, Troy Hopper.
Cora, a graduate of Franklin High School class of 1963, loved spending time with her family, reading, solving puzzles and crocheting.
She is survived by her daughter, Patrica "Patty" (Vance) Wall; son, James "Keith" (Shelli) Henry; grandson, Trevor Wall; sisters, Betty (John) Allen and Wanda Lou Pritchett; brothers, Floyd (Alice) Hopper, Roy (Pattie) Hopper and Harvey (Cheryl) Hopper; brother-in-law, Hoyt Helton; and caregiver, Alisha Sumner.
A graveside service was held at 11 a.m., Friday, July 11, at the Burningtown Baptist Church Cemetery. Reverend Randy Drinnon officiated. In honor of Cora's relaxed spirit, guests were invited to dress comfortably.
A time for viewing and quiet reflection was held for family and friends at Macon Funeral Home Thursday, July 10.
Online condolences can be made at maconfuneralhome.com. Macon Funeral Home is handling the arrangements.
